about summary refs log tree commit diff stats
path: root/src/update/mod.rs (follow)
Commit message (Collapse)AuthorAge
* refactor(treewide): Combine the separate crates in one workspaceBenedikt Peetz2024-10-14
|
* feat(videos): Provide a consistent display for the `Video` structBenedikt Peetz2024-10-14
| | | | | Before, `Video`s where colourized differently, just because the colourization was not standardized. It now is.
* feat(cli): Add a `add` commandBenedikt Peetz2024-10-07
| | | | | | This command allows adding URLs directly. Otherwise, the process would be: `yt subs add <URL>` -> `yt update` -> `yt subs remove <URL>`
* style(treewide): ReformatBenedikt Peetz2024-08-25
|
* refactor(treewide): Conform to `cargo clippy`Benedikt Peetz2024-08-25
|
* feat(select/display): Also show the video hash when color displaying itBenedikt Peetz2024-08-24
| | | | The hash can now be used on the commandline to access video information.
* style(treewide): FormatBenedikt Peetz2024-08-23
|
* fix(update): Propagate the logging options to the `update_raw.py` scriptBenedikt Peetz2024-08-22
|
* fix(update): Correctly treat a success as a successBenedikt Peetz2024-08-22
|
* perf(raw_update.py)!: Don't fetch entries that are already in the databaseBenedikt Peetz2024-08-22
| | | | | | | | | | | | | | | | | | | | Testing has resulted in a speed-up of circa 3400% (updates of 1 subscription (which is already fully stored) are now ca. 1 sec from previously 34 sec). BREAKING CHANGE: The extractor hash is now calculated from the `id` and not the `webpage_url` field requiring a complete re-fetch of all stored videos. ```bash $# export your subscriptions: $ yt subs list --urls > subs.txt $# remove the old database $ mv ~/.local/share/yt/videos.sqlite{,.old} $# reimport the subsciptions $ yt subs import subs.txt $# refetch all videos $ yt upadate ```
* docs(yt_dlp/lib): Improve some commentsBenedikt Peetz2024-08-21
|
* fix(update): Use the `raw_update.py` from the pathBenedikt Peetz2024-08-21
|
* chore: Initial CommitBenedikt Peetz2024-08-21
This repository was migrated out of my nixos-config.